Global Education PartnershipGlobal Education Partnership (G.E.P.) is an international non-profit organization with divisions in Oakland, California (U.S.), Kenya, Guatemala, Tanzania and Indonesia. The mission of G.E.P. is to “provide access to educational resources that increase the capacity of young people to become employable and self-reliant in today’s global marketplace.” In the San Francisco Bay Area, Global Education Partnership offers the Entrepreneurship and Employment Training Program (EETP) to approximately 250 low-income youth per year. Students learn entrepreneurship skills using the socially responsible business model (how to succeed in business e.g. finance, marketing, accounting, youth-designed service projects); work readiness skills (e.g. resume-writing, interviewing, presentation skills); skills for the global marketplace (e.g. Internet communication with students in G.E.P.’s international divisions; students manage a business selling imported handcrafts); computer skills (e.g. Microsoft Word, Excel, Internet). G.E.P. also offers Follow-up Services to assist graduates of the EETP with college guidance, job and internship placements, and starting businesses. In Kenya, Guatemala, Tanzania and Indonesia, Global Education Partnership matches community-raised funds for school-based development projects (e.g., textbooks, desks, classroom construction, etc.) in rural communities in addition to offering the EETP and Follow-up Services in Global Education Partnership’s rural computer facilities (each stocked with 25 Windows-based Pentium computers).
